Hello. You are bidding on a 1969 Camaro rolling shell from California. It was actually a pretty straight solid car to start with. All panels are original born with GM other than a drivers side quarter skin replacement and semi-smoothed firewall. The quarter skin was replaced because of dents, NOT because of rust. Firewall was smoothed but will still accept the original heater box, wiper motor, etc. Every square inch, inside and out of the car has been media blasted and the car has been stored indoors since so you can see whats there. I spent $1000 in blasting alone. It is extremely dry here in Nevada, so as you can see, the car really doesnt even have any surface or flash rust since then. Subframe is straight. The body as you can see, for the most part is excellent just needing minor bodywork and finishing from here. There is some holes left after the blasting process from rust on the passengers footboards (pictured). The surrounding metal is very solid and in my oppinion, and can be welded up. I don`t feel that its necessary to cut out and replace floorpans etc in this area, unless you like creating work for yourself. However, if you decide to patch the patch areas aren`t that big. Note the package tray area hasn`t been hacked to death and the dash remains unmodified as well. I had big plans with this car, but I just never found the time so it needs to go. The car will be sold as pictured and does have a clear California title.
